MKLeb
1a28cc7b8f
change to newer AMI
2022-06-17 09:29:19 -06:00
MKLeb
ec06002600
Test on actual CentOS Stream 9 AMI
2022-06-17 09:29:19 -06:00
Kirill Ponomarev
571e62aecb
Add Ubuntu 22.04 ( #62100 )
...
* Add Ubuntu 22.04
* upgrade m2crypto requirement for linux pyversion>=3.10 to deal with build errors
* Allow signing before returning when testrun=True to cooperate with M2Crypto=0.38.0
* Skip test_py36_target when docker container resets ssh connection
* check the json stderr this time
* check raw stdout for connection closed message instead
* Actually check for the right text this time
* changelog
* Change m2crypto requirements across the board
Co-authored-by: MKLeb <calebb@vmware.com>
Co-authored-by: Caleb Beard <53276404+MKLeb@users.noreply.github.com>
2022-06-14 11:56:15 -07:00
krionbsd
3f3c5c16c9
Remove Fedora 34 - EoL
2022-05-24 14:46:51 -04:00
Pedro Algarvio
9bac6eef7f
Same test run timeout as windows
...
Signed-off-by: Pedro Algarvio <palgarvio@vmware.com>
2022-05-20 12:07:09 -07:00
Pedro Algarvio
350661cb2b
Use Python 3.9 on macOS
...
Signed-off-by: Pedro Algarvio <palgarvio@vmware.com>
2022-05-20 12:07:09 -07:00
Pedro Algarvio
b7f278a6fd
Use the newer nox platforms file which installs Py3.9
...
Signed-off-by: Pedro Algarvio <palgarvio@vmware.com>
2022-05-20 12:07:09 -07:00
krionbsd
0c24ec24f4
Add FreeBSD 13.1
2022-05-17 10:24:39 -04:00
krionbsd
c97b86ce3a
Add Fedora 35 ami
2022-04-28 09:00:20 -04:00
Pedro Algarvio
5765b31dd7
We no longer need to skip pre-commit hooks on branch builds
...
Signed-off-by: Pedro Algarvio <palgarvio@vmware.com>
2022-04-08 09:14:55 -04:00
Megan Wilhite
7d0aa1ab33
Bump amazon ci timeout to 7
2022-03-07 12:51:31 -08:00
Pedro Algarvio
ee8a9a7b54
Update to newer Amazon Linux 2 AMI with increased disk size
...
Signed-off-by: Pedro Algarvio <palgarvio@vmware.com>
2022-03-01 14:38:37 -08:00
Pedro Algarvio
25c7a16b4f
Update to newer Arch Linux AMI
...
Signed-off-by: Pedro Algarvio <palgarvio@vmware.com>
2022-02-28 08:29:49 -08:00
krionbsd
a1bfe835fa
Add new windows ami
2022-02-23 14:33:38 -05:00
Megan Wilhite
f6f9b32588
[WIP] Update amazon linux 2 ami ( #61663 )
...
* Update amazon linux 2 ami
* Update amazon linux 2 ami
Co-authored-by: krionbsd <krion@FreeBSD.org>
2022-02-20 07:45:54 -08:00
Gareth J. Greenaway
38d1ac9e77
moving the jenkins file to the right location.
2022-02-18 12:12:58 -05:00
Gareth J. Greenaway
00ee5eed1d
various changes and fixes needed to add PhotonOS into CICD.
2022-02-18 12:12:58 -05:00
krionbsd
281bbdb20a
Add new fbsd image
2022-02-13 14:53:09 -07:00
krionbsd
2d3d79de3c
Remove CentOS 8 from CI as it's reached its end-of-life
2022-02-02 12:42:18 -05:00
krionbsd
b66e04d2ac
Temporary disable Fedora-35 until slow tests are fixed
2021-12-03 15:33:49 -05:00
Bryce Larson
50eb968621
add fedora 35
2021-11-22 15:09:05 -08:00
Bryce Larson
87d294374a
remove support for macos mojave
2021-10-27 17:32:52 -07:00
ScriptAutomate
95843170f7
Latest Windows 2016 and 2019 AMIs
2021-09-26 08:48:45 -07:00
Bryce Larson
8c52f27cc6
add debian 11 arm64
2021-09-23 08:05:02 -04:00
Pedro Algarvio
5d75291845
Don't fail on known doc failures
2021-08-19 07:31:52 -04:00
Pedro Algarvio
d77f3ef36b
Also check for proper versionadded
versions
...
Refs #59077
2021-08-19 07:31:52 -04:00
Pedro Algarvio
5f62e0b312
Don't enforce the presence of __virtualname__
yet
2021-08-19 07:31:52 -04:00
Pedro Algarvio
ba177ad738
Check loader modules __virtual__
and salt/modules/*.py
with pre-commit
...
Fixes #58537
2021-08-19 07:31:52 -04:00
Megan Wilhite
4367e1d481
Increase timeout for centos tests
2021-08-17 13:32:05 -04:00
krionbsd
79e2470a39
update FreeBSD AMI
2021-08-16 18:01:32 -07:00
Joe Eacott
4f05242f36
update windows amis
2021-08-09 14:01:39 -07:00
Bryce Larson
ec7203d346
update arch ami to fix low disk space on /tmp/ problem
2021-07-28 17:48:16 -07:00
twangboy
5aed369606
Update salt url, update amis for windows
2021-07-23 13:06:52 -07:00
Bryce Larson
3beb95af3c
add centosstream-8
2021-07-20 07:11:36 -04:00
Bryce Larson
b924ecb6e9
update jenkinsfile for debian-11 to match others
2021-07-20 07:11:36 -04:00
Bryce Larson
a0f1087796
add amis.yml
2021-07-20 07:11:36 -04:00
Bryce Larson
cae2e2fb6a
update to opensuse 15.3
2021-07-15 11:48:59 -04:00
Pedro Algarvio
bdda87f2cc
Switch to master-1.11
so that a `salt/_version.py
` is always written
...
Prior to uploading the source code to the VM to be tested
2021-07-12 19:07:53 -07:00
Bryce Larson
b4ff83902a
add debian 11 to ci tests
2021-07-07 08:01:48 -04:00
Bryce Larson
3a285ab0a8
remove comments from jenkins files
2021-07-07 08:01:48 -04:00
krionbsd
5a4d9c3d2f
Remove FreeBSD-12.2
2021-06-29 14:43:35 -07:00
Pedro Algarvio
5b3164e478
Use the new macos platforms file
2021-06-21 06:49:49 -04:00
krionbsd
d89ad4088c
Increase volume size to 40G on FreeBSD, remove tmpfs on /tmp on Fedora
2021-06-18 21:24:55 +01:00
Bryce Larson
e3545c6900
add AlmaLinux 8
2021-06-04 06:51:28 -04:00
twangboy
97309dc79b
Let Mac OS Mojave run for 8 hours to avoid timeout
2021-05-26 15:07:37 -07:00
Bryce Larson
07d5d2b738
add fedora-34
2021-05-18 13:49:00 -04:00
krionbsd
f3c263c8a4
Add ARM64 support for Ubuntu20 pipeline
2021-04-26 11:24:57 -07:00
krionbsd
a23c1d2eca
Add new AMIs for FreeBSD 12.2 and 13.0
2021-04-15 06:51:35 -04:00
Bryce Larson
9e33ee850c
changing the cloud platforms file missed in 24b69a9e38
2021-04-11 12:16:40 -07:00
Bryce Larson
24b69a9e38
add distro_arch
2021-04-09 14:54:17 -07:00